Download the PHP package symfony/symfony-installer without Composer

On this page you can find all versions of the php package symfony/symfony-installer. It is possible to download/install these versions without Composer. Possible dependencies are resolved automatically.

FAQ

After the download, you have to make one include require_once('vendor/autoload.php');. After that you have to import the classes with use statements.

Example:
If you use only one package a project is not needed. But if you use more then one package, without a project it is not possible to import the classes with use statements.

In general, it is recommended to use always a project to download your libraries. In an application normally there is more than one library needed.
Some PHP packages are not free to download and because of that hosted in private repositories. In this case some credentials are needed to access such packages. Please use the auth.json textarea to insert credentials, if a package is coming from a private repository. You can look here for more information.

  • Some hosting areas are not accessible by a terminal or SSH. Then it is not possible to use Composer.
  • To use Composer is sometimes complicated. Especially for beginners.
  • Composer needs much resources. Sometimes they are not available on a simple webspace.
  • If you are using private repositories you don't need to share your credentials. You can set up everything on our site and then you provide a simple download link to your team member.
  • Simplify your Composer build process. Use our own command line tool to download the vendor folder as binary. This makes your build process faster and you don't need to expose your credentials for private repositories.
Please rate this library. Is it a good library?

Informations about the package symfony-installer

Symfony Installer

This is the official installer to start new projects based on the Symfony full-stack framework. The installer is only compatible with Symfony 2 and 3.

Creating Symfony 4 projects

This installer is not compatible with Symfony 4 and newer versions. Instead, use Composer and create your Symfony 4 project as follows:

See the Symfony Installation article on the official Symfony Documentation for more details.

Installing the installer

This step is only needed the first time you use the installer:

Linux and Mac OS X

Windows

Move the downloaded symfony file to your projects directory and execute it as follows:

If you prefer to create a global symfony command, execute the following:

Then, move both files (symfony and symfony.bat) to any location included in your execution path. Now you can run the symfony command anywhere on your system.

Using the installer

1. Start a new project with the latest stable Symfony version

Execute the new command and provide the name of your project as the only argument:

2. Start a new project with the latest Symfony LTS (Long Term Support) version

Execute the new command and provide the name of your project as the first argument and lts as the second argument. The installer will automatically select the most recent LTS (Long Term Support) version available:

3. Start a new project based on a specific Symfony branch

Execute the new command and provide the name of your project as the first argument and the branch number as the second argument. The installer will automatically select the most recent version available for the given branch:

4. Start a new project based on a specific Symfony version

Execute the new command and provide the name of your project as the first argument and the exact Symfony version as the second argument:

5. Install the Symfony demo application

The Symfony Demo is a reference application developed using the official Symfony Best Practices:

Updating the installer

New versions of the Symfony Installer are released regularly. To update your installer version, execute the following command:

NOTE

If your system requires the use of a proxy server to download contents, the installer tries to guess the best proxy settings from the HTTP_PROXY and http_proxy environment variables. Make sure any of them is set before executing the Symfony Installer.

Troubleshooting

SSL and certificates issues on Windows systems

If you experience any error related with SSL or security certificates when using the Symfony Installer on Windows systems:

1) Check that the OpenSSL extension is enabled in your php.ini configuration:

2) Check that the path to the file that contains the security certificates exists and is defined in php.ini:

If you can't locate the cacert.pem file anywhere on your system, you can safely download it from the official website of the cURL project: http://curl.haxx.se/ca/cacert.pem


All versions of symfony-installer with dependencies

PHP Build Version
Package Version
Requires php Version >=5.4.0
guzzlehttp/guzzle Version ^5.3.1
symfony/console Version ~2.6
symfony/filesystem Version ~2.5
raulfraile/distill Version ~0.9,!=0.9.3,!=0.9.4
Composer command for our command line client (download client) This client runs in each environment. You don't need a specific PHP version etc. The first 20 API calls are free. Standard composer command

The package symfony/symfony-installer contains the following files

Loading the files please wait ....